Output 3343e30589801fb56957043021d434dcde31b49374df02929c8c1813a09ab51d:0

value
46785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a629e2a4a63534d45f41dddb1d80c59503cc484 OP_EQUAL
address
3FmL8AyWRasJtcfQEDHiyUhS6KAoSWe4Li
transaction
3343e30589801fb56957043021d434dcde31b49374df02929c8c1813a09ab51d
spent
true